Do you need a car in Gilmer, TX?

Having a car in Gilmer, TX can greatly improve job accessibility. The city is spread out, and public transportation options are limited. A car allows job seekers to reach various workplaces easily and on time.


Public transportation in Gilmer is not very reliable for daily commutes. Many employers prefer candidates who can drive to their jobs. Owning a car increases flexibility and expands the job search to a broader area, improving employment opportunities.

What is the job market like in Gilmer, TX?

The job market in Gilmer, TX, offers a variety of opportunities for job seekers. This small town, located in Upshur County, has a diverse economy with various sectors hiring. Key industries include healthcare, education, manufacturing, and retail. These industries provide stable employment and a range of positions to suit different skill sets.

Job openings in Gilmer often include positions such as nurses, teachers, factory workers, and retail staff. The area's healthcare sector, supported by facilities like Christus Good Shepherd Medical Center, frequently hires for various roles. Education positions can be found at local schools and colleges, offering career growth and community involvement. The manufacturing sector provides steady jobs for skilled labor, while retail stores often need employees for part-time or full-time roles.
